Welcome notes for the eng sync: Nightloom is our scheduler for nightly data backfills across the Arden cluster. It plans runs at 23:30, executes by 01:00, and writes completion markers the morning dashboards depend on, so delays here cascade visibly. Nightloom authenticates to the backfill API with a credential managed by the Stowe platform group and rotated quarterly. Before first launch, add the following line to Nightloom's .env:

vault entry, yahaf-tagug: LEDGER_TOKEN20=884d77d1a8b98aa4edfb

TICKET: Signature check failed — replica-lag alarm bundle

The Norridge read-replica lag alarm failed to deploy overnight because its config bundle failed signature verification. Root cause: the bundle was signed with the retired Q3 key after last week's rotation. Lag alerting is currently running on the previous bundle, so coverage is intact but thresholds are stale. To unblock, re-sign the bundle and redeploy. The current valid deploy key is included below.

rollout seal: bky19_M1Zvn1YQwEBTy4XxP3H

Ticket: Catalogue import for the Hollowmere branch library stalls at roughly 40% when the Fernwick ingest service hits records with duplicate shelf codes. The dedupe pass was added in last month's Quillhaven release but isn't enabled for batch imports. Workaround: split the import file into chunks under 5,000 rows. A proper fix is scheduled for the next sprint. When reporting reproductions, include the build token printed below.

pipeline stamp: htk31_f769b577b3028a4e9958e5bb8d1259a

# Break-Glass: Catalog Cache Invalidation

Scope: the Pinrow product catalog at Veldstone Retail. If stale prices persist after a purge and the Hollowmere invalidation queue is wedged, use break-glass to flush the edge tier directly. Contractors: get verbal sign-off from the catalog lead first. Steps: open the Hollowmere admin shell, select emergency-flush, confirm the tenant, and run it once — repeated flushes thrash the origin. Access is logged and expires after 20 minutes. Unseal the admin shell with the passphrase below.

recovery phrase for kahop-tajog: istix-casvan